How they compare

Kiribati currently reports 6,309 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re against 5,543 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re in Tuvalu, a difference of 766 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re.

That makes Kiribati's figure about 1.1 times Tuvalu's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Tuvalu ahead.

Kiribati ranks 103rd and Tuvalu ranks 106th of 200 countries.

Tuvalu has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kiribati Tuvalu Difference Ahead
2000s 1,462 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 12,459 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 10,998 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re Tuvalu
2010s -715.75 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 12,653 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 13,369 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re Tuvalu
2020s 4,024 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 5,543 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re 1,519 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re Tuvalu

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
